ERD Wins Important New Multiple Award BPA worth up to $9.9M to Provide Social Science Support Services to NOAA
The National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ration’s Coastal Services Center (CSC) has awarded Abt Associates one of four awards on their Social Science Support Service BPA, with a potential value over five years of up to $9.9 million. Under the scope of this BPA contract, Abt will compete for task orders to support CSC’s core mission of helping local, state, and national organizations address complex coastal issues and thrive in the face of significant natural and economic risks. We will provide the high-quality social science expertise, strategic planning, and public participation and communication capabilities that CSC requires to accomplish this increasingly demanding mission.
This collaborative effort involved Abt SRBI and a broad range of external partners, resulting in a team that covers the full suite of professional disciplines needed to meet CSC’s broad and expanding support needs. This true team approach allows Abt to meet all of CSC’s potential requirements and compete effectively on future task orders.
According to Mike Conti, ERD Division Vice President, “This is an important win that establishes Abt’s presence with a new client. We are excited to have this opportunity to work with NOAA to meet the interesting and broad ranging challenges that coastal communities face.”
